What is Manual Metal Arc Welding?

Manual Metal Arc Welding (MMAW), also known as Shielded Metal Arc Welding (SMAW), is a welding process that uses a consumable electrode covered in a flux coating. The electrode is held in one hand, and an electric arc is formed, joining the electrode and the base metal.

As the arc melts the electrode and the base metal, the flux coating melts and creates a shield of gas and slag, which protects the weld pool from contamination.

MMAW is a versatile welding process that can weld a wide range of metals and alloys, making it a popular preference in various industries, including construction, shipbuilding, and pipeline welding.

Here are some industries where manual metal arc welding is applicable:

  • Construction industry: MMAW is commonly used in the construction industry for welding steel structures, such as bridges, buildings, and pipelines. Its ability to solder thick materials and its versatility in welding in all positions make it a popular choice for construction applications.
  • Shipbuilding industry: MMAW is also widely used in the shipbuilding industry for welding steel structures, including hulls, decks, and bulkheads. It is preferred for welding in tight spaces and overhead welding due to its portability and versatility.
  • Automotive industry: MMAW is used in the automotive industry for repairing and fabricating metal components, including frames, exhaust systems, and body panels. Its versatility in welding various metals and its low equipment cost make it a cost-effective option for small-scale welding operations.
  • Oil and gas industry: MMAW is used in the oil and gas industry for welding pipelines, storage tanks, and pressure vessels.   • Aerospace industry: MMAW is used in the aerospace industry for welding aircraft structures and components, including fuel tanks and engine parts. Its ability to produce high-quality welds and its versatility in soldering various materials make it a preferred choice for aircraft welding applications.
  • Manufacturing industry: MMAW is used in the manufacturing industry for welding metal parts and components, including machinery, equipment, and tools. Its versatility in welding various metals and alloys makes it a popular choice in this industry.
